In general, while genomic DNA sequencing reveals inherited mutations, Gene expression profiling (RNA-Seq) captures real-time functional gene activity. Essentially, total RNA is extracted, purified, depleted of ribosomal RNA, converted into cDNA, and sequenced on high-throughput NGS platforms. Therefore, bioinformatic software maps reads to quantify exact gene expression levels. Additionally, to read about technological advances, examine the Nature Reviews Genetics journal.

When Is RNA Sequencing Recommended?
For example, medical oncologists and hematologists order Gene expression profiling for advanced or refractory cancers to discover rare gene fusions. In particular, testing is recommended for lung adenocarcinoma, soft tissue sarcomas, pediatric tumors, and hematologic malignancies. Moreover, it is used in rare genetic disease research when DNA sequencing yields uninformative results. Why RNA-Seq Identifies Fusions Hidden in Long Intronic Regions
Ideally, oncologists should order Gene expression profiling (RNA-Seq) because genomic DNA panels often miss gene fusions occurring across vast, repetitive intronic regions. In addition, Gene expression profiling directly captures expressed chimeric mRNA transcripts without intron interference. Comparison: RNA Sequencing (RNA-Seq) vs. DNA Exome (WES)
On one hand, DNA Whole Exome Sequencing (WES) analyzes coding exon mutations, whereas Gene expression profiling (RNA-Seq) measures active gene expression and expressed fusion transcripts.
